Classification & USGS reference
Within Oxford County, Maine, the U.S. Geological Survey lists Hedgehog Hill as a summit on the Old Speck Mountain topographic quadrangle (FIPS 23/017), under Feature ID 567890. Last revised by the Board on Geographic Names on 07/16/2022.
Coordinates & physical setting
Hedgehog Hill sits at 44.60138° N, 70.92986° W (DMS 44°36′05″ N, 70°55′47″ W).
